Cathepsin K/TRAP: Can they be used to induce osteogenesis
Medical Hypotheses, 02/04/09
Aydin HM et al. - Delivering these enzymes (TRAP and cathepsin K) and/or other molecules involved in bone resorption into bone defects and thus obtaining a concentration difference in the levels of these materials may induce bone forming cells to balance bone turnover, therefore inducing bone regeneration.
